操作系统
森格的博
数据库领域学习者,付出就会收获!
展开
-
PV操作每日一题-银行业务问题
银行业务问题一、问题描述二、问题求解三、碎碎念一、问题描述某大型银行办理人民币储蓄业务,由n个储蓄员负责。每个顾客进入银行后先至取号机取一个号,并且在等待区找到空沙发坐下等待叫号,取号机给出的号码依次递增,并假定有足够多的空沙发容纳顾客,当一个储蓄员空闲下来,就交一个号,请用信号量和PV操作解决该问题。二、问题求解????:semaphore customerNum=0;semaphore serverNum=n;semaphore mutex=1;customer-i(i=1,2,3原创 2021-12-08 12:39:51 · 2129 阅读 · 0 评论 -
【操作系统】常见简答题整理(更新完毕)
操作系统考研常见的一些简答题的整理,希望对大家有帮助。原创 2021-12-06 23:26:40 · 13540 阅读 · 4 评论 -
PV操作每日一题-农夫猎人问题
有一个铁笼子,每次只能放入一个动物。猎人向笼中放入老虎,农夫向笼中放入羊,动物园等待取笼中的老虎,饭店等待取笼中的羊。原创 2021-12-03 23:33:01 · 2696 阅读 · 0 评论 -
PV操作每日一题-哲学家进餐问题
哲学家进餐问题,特别经典的一道题,一起来练练手!原创 2021-11-28 19:42:28 · 989 阅读 · 0 评论 -
PV操作每日一题-独木桥问题(变式二)
独木桥问题变式二,要求各方向的汽车串行过桥,但当另一方提出过桥时,应能阻止对方未上桥的后继车辆,待桥面的车过完后,另一方的汽车开始过桥。原创 2021-11-27 11:53:43 · 2170 阅读 · 6 评论 -
PV操作每日一题-独木桥问题(变式一)
独木桥问题变式一,要求桥面上最多可以有K辆汽车通过。原创 2021-11-27 11:09:37 · 1446 阅读 · 1 评论 -
PV操作每日一题-独木桥问题
一类经典的读者写者问题,欢迎一起学习!原创 2021-11-27 10:03:19 · 2544 阅读 · 4 评论 -
PV操作每日一题-餐厅上菜问题
和独木桥问题相似,大家冲冲冲!原创 2021-11-22 22:37:58 · 312 阅读 · 0 评论 -
PV操作每日一题-考试问题
某学校即将进行期末考试,每个考场有N个学生,1个老师。无论进出,考场门口每次只能通过一人,采用先来先进,先做完先走人。规定:当N个学生全部进入考场后,老师才能发卷子;学生需要等待老师的开考信号发出才可答题;学生交卷后即可走,老师需要等待所有学生交卷后将试卷封闭后才可离开考场。假设把老师和学生均看作进程,请问PV操作解决上述问题中的同步与互斥,并说明信号量及初值的含义。原创 2021-11-20 22:46:52 · 917 阅读 · 2 评论 -
PV操作每日一题-黑白棋子问题(变式)
有一个盒子中放有数量相等的黑白棋子各100枚,现在用自动分拣系统将黑白棋子分开,系统中有两个进程P1和P2。P1负责白棋子的分拣,P2则负责黑棋子的分拣,两者必须交替进行分拣,按黑先白后的次序进行,且分拣结束前不得停止。用PV操作解决该问题。原创 2021-11-18 21:19:27 · 1510 阅读 · 3 评论 -
PV操作每日一题-黑白棋子问题
温馨提示,这个题目的代码可能很简单,但是有点绕,类似于前面的橘子苹果问题的交替放入水果。好啦,开始!原创 2021-11-17 22:21:08 · 2379 阅读 · 4 评论 -
PV操作每日一题-橘子苹果问题(高阶版变式)
昨天的高阶版还是有挑战,今天一起看个它的变式好啦。原创 2021-11-16 22:06:07 · 1388 阅读 · 0 评论 -
PV操作每日一题-橘子苹果问题(高阶版)
等到了,橘子苹果问题高阶版!!冲呀!原创 2021-11-15 22:10:57 · 2238 阅读 · 13 评论 -
PV操作每日一题-缓冲区问题(进阶版)
缓冲区问题-进阶版原创 2021-11-14 17:22:27 · 1024 阅读 · 0 评论 -
PV操作每日一题-橘子苹果问题(进阶版)
进阶版的橘子苹果问题,盘子中可以放入N个水果!原创 2021-11-14 17:17:36 · 2803 阅读 · 0 评论 -
PV操作每日一题-橘子苹果问题(初阶版)
橘子苹果问题-初阶版原创 2021-11-12 22:28:35 · 3221 阅读 · 0 评论 -
PV操作汇总篇
时常更新原创 2021-11-11 22:51:54 · 325 阅读 · 0 评论 -
PV操作每日一题-缓冲区问题
缓冲区问题的求解!原创 2021-11-11 20:49:52 · 1008 阅读 · 1 评论 -
PV操作每日一题-售票问题
炒鸡经典的同步问题-售票问题原创 2021-11-10 21:03:51 · 2923 阅读 · 0 评论 -
PV操作每日一题-吸烟者问题
三个吸烟者在一个房间内,还有一个香烟供应者。为了制造并抽掉香烟,每个吸烟者需要三样东西:烟草、纸和火柴,供应者有着丰富货物提供。三个吸烟者中,第一个有自己的烟草,第二个有自己的纸,第三个有自己的火柴。供应者随机地将两样东西放在桌子上,允许一个吸烟者进行吸烟。当吸烟者完成吸烟后唤醒供应者,供应者再把两样东西放在桌子上,同时唤醒另一个吸烟者。试用信号量机制和PV操作求解该问题。原创 2021-11-09 22:40:56 · 2871 阅读 · 1 评论 -
PV操作-写在最前
PV大题的一些解题思路和注意事项原创 2021-11-08 22:54:11 · 354 阅读 · 0 评论 -
PV操作每日一题-读者写者问题
读者写者问题:读者优先以及写者优先。原创 2021-11-08 20:34:55 · 1788 阅读 · 0 评论